Inspired by Blueberries

We're not sure why, but we don't have many chipmunks at the cottage this year which means we have lots of blueberries. It is a tough call which we like more.






Aren't blue and green the best together?  I'm in love with this colour combination lately.  And I'm seeing it everywhere. 

Like in the blue of the canoe and lake against the green forest.  Does it get any more relaxing than this scene?



Or the blue and green June Hosta in my Mother's cottage garden. Such a beauty and definitely my favourite hosta? 



Or the blue and green drapes in our cottage bedroom window. The same fabric had been used for dining room drapes in our home in Nigeria when I was young and I remember them blowing against the back of my head in the wind when we ate dinner - until they were stolen one night by some thieves that is.  My Mother got more of the same fabric to replace the stolen drapes. I'm so glad she thought to bring the extra fabric home, though, as I love these drapes at the cottage when the morning light shines through them. 



And I can't leave out the blues I recently introduced into our family room that mingle well with the soft greens (you can read about it here).



Isn't blue and green the perfect summer colour combination.
